Senior Living Facility Casa de las Campanas - proxSafe maxx

The Golden Years - Senior Living Facility has Mastered Key Management

When Southern California senior living facility Casa de las Campanas needed to implement an effective method for managing keys, officials asked Deister Electronics to help them design a proxSafe electronic key management system. The system had to be secure, efficient and reliable. With an average population of 570 residents, ranging across all levels of care, the facility's management feels a strong sense of responsibility to their clients. Like many healthcare and senior care facilities, Casa de las Campanas was cognizant of the need for greater efficiency and security required in today's fast-paced world. They recognized the increased cost of manning key stations and log books, replacing lost keys and cylinders, and tracking down misplaced keys. Security also is a primary concern as residents, patients and families expect utmost safety when selecting a long-term care facility. Casa needed a system that was scalable, easy to use and networkable. Management wanted an electronic key management system that would grant them access to certain keys on a temporary basis. Management at Casa de las Campanas carefully vetted several key control products, including the proxSafe key management system by Deister Electronics USA Inc., of Manassas, Va. Officials selected the proxSafe system based on Casa's needs but also because of Deister's experience with RFID technologies for security and logistics. The proxSafe system provided a networkable system with Web-based software, as well as maintenance-free RFID key tags. Casa's management had researched the company's history and felt very confident in the level and longevity of technical support available.
